What are Formal Dining Room Chair Cushions?

Formal dining room chair cushions are seat pads or chair pads that are designed specifically for use in a formal dining room setting. They are typically made from high-quality materials such as velvet, silk, or linen, and are often adorned with intricate details such as tassels, fringe, or embroidery.

Why are Formal Dining Room Chair Cushions Important?

Formal dining room chair cushions serve several important purposes. First and foremost, they provide an extra layer of comfort for guests during long meals. They also add a touch of elegance and sophistication to the dining room, helping to create a formal and inviting atmosphere. Additionally, they can be used to tie together the various design elements of the room, such as the table linens, curtains, and wall art.

Pros and Cons of Formal Dining Room Chair Cushions

Like any home decor element, there are both pros and cons to using formal dining room chair cushions. Here are some to consider:

Pros:

  • Add an extra layer of comfort to the dining experience.
  • Create a sense of elegance and sophistication in the dining room.
  • Help tie together the various design elements of the room.
  • Can be used to add pops of color and visual interest to the dining space.

Cons:

  • Require regular cleaning and maintenance.
  • May not be suitable for households with pets or young children who are prone to spills and accidents.
  • Can be expensive, especially if you opt for high-quality materials and intricate details.
  • May not be suitable for all dining room styles and aesthetics.

Question & Answer and FAQs

Q: Can I use formal dining room chair cushions in a casual dining space?

A: While formal dining room chair cushions are designed specifically for use in a formal dining space, there’s no reason why you can’t use them in a casual dining area if you like the look and feel. However, keep in mind that they may not be the best fit for all casual dining room styles and aesthetics.

Q: How often should I clean my formal dining room chair cushions?

A: The frequency with which you should clean your formal dining room chair cushions will depend on how often they are used and how dirty they get. In general, it’s a good idea to spot clean them as needed and give them a more thorough cleaning every few months or so.

Q: What materials are best for formal dining room chair cushions?

A: High-quality materials such as velvet, silk, or linen are often used for formal dining room chair cushions. However, the best material for your cushions will depend on your personal preferences and the overall style of your dining room.
